Phrasal Verbs With 'Weasel'

Weasel out phrasal verb

  1. Meaning: Back out of a commitment
    (Intransitive | International English)
    » Example: I'm supposed to go on Thursday, but I am going to WEASEL OUT.

Weasel out of phrasal verb

  1. Meaning: Back out of a commitment
    (Inseparable | International English)
    » Example: They're trying to WEASEL OUT OF our agreement.
